Pro Tips for Power Users

  1. Keyboard-driven: Ctrl+Shift+N = new connection, Ctrl+Shift+L = start listener, Ctrl+Shift+H = toggle hex view.
  2. Auto-reconnect: Right-click any closed connection tab and enable "Auto-reconnect on failure" – useful for persistent reverse shells.
  3. Pipe to external tools: Go to Settings > External Commands and set up a pipeline (e.g., send received data to wireshark or jq).
  4. UDP mode with stats: Unlike CLI netcat, v13 shows packet loss percentage and jitter for UDP streams.
